The actual range around Tully's last frost
05/06 is the middle of 30 years of NOAA records, not a promise. Getting tender plants in by 04/25 carries real risk, frost has hit that late in about 9 of 10 years here. Wait until 05/21 and only about 1 year in 10 sees frost after that.
